NettetThe Journal of Population Economics is a quarterly peer-reviewed academic journal that covers research on economic and demographic problems. It is the official journal of the European Society of Population Economics and is published by Springer Science+Business Media in collaboration with POP at UNU-MERIT and the Global … Nettet13. apr. 2024 · Background Research clearly demonstrates that income matters greatly to health.
